2022 ETB to VUV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2022

During 2022, the ETB to VUV ex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on October 23, valuing the pair at 2.3740.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on April 21, dropping to 2.1681.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.2059 VUV.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 2.2836 to the December average rate of 2.2074, the exchange rate registered a net change of -3.34%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2022 high of 2.3740 was down 14.60% compared to the 2021 peak of 2.7798,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 2.2337, compared to 2.2667 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 0.0330 points.

H1 Avg (Jan–Jun) 2.2337
H2 Avg (Jul–Dec) 2.2667

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2022 was October, with a trading range of 0.0987 VUV (High: 2.3740 / Low: 2.2754). On the other end, January was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0313 VUV (High: 2.3029 / Low: 2.2715).

October Spread (Volatile) ±0.0987
January Spread (Stable) ±0.0313

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 2.3029 2.2715 2.2836
February 2.2769 2.2301 2.2551
March 2.2434 2.1968 2.2234
April 2.2182 2.1681 2.1898
May 2.2479 2.1978 2.2216
June 2.2501 2.2013 2.2288
July 2.2872 2.2450 2.2628
August 2.2629 2.1958 2.2305
September 2.2969 2.2194 2.2538
October 2.3740 2.2754 2.3340
November 2.3551 2.2876 2.3116
December 2.2888 2.1980 2.2074
